- The distance between Whangapoua Forest, New Zealand and Pecs, Hungary is approximately 17,877 km or 11,109 mi.
- To reach Whangapoua Forest in this distance one would set out from Pecs bearing 69.4°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Whangapoua Forest bearing 125.8° or SE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Whangapoua Forest is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Pecs is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 4.3 °C (7.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13 °C (23.4°F) less in Whangapoua Forest.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1243.8 mm (49 in) more which is equivalent to 1243.8 l/m² (30.53 US gal/ft²) or 12,438,000 l/ha (1,329,705 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.5° higher in Whangapoua Forest than in Pecs.
